Dunkirk attractions for couples
Dunkirk, a vibrant port city in Nord, France, offers an intriguing blend of history and modernity for the discerning traveller. Begin your exploration at the Dunkirk War Museum, where immersive exhibits narrate the gripping tales of World War II, leaving visitors with a deeper understanding of the city's pivotal role during the conflict. For a leisurely afternoon, head to the sandy shores of Malo-les-Bains, where you can relax on the beach or enjoy a stroll along the promenade dotted with charming cafes and seafood restaurants. Art lovers will appreciate the contemporary works showcased at the FRAC Nord-Pas de Calais, a regional contemporary art museum known for its striking architecture and rotating exhibitions. Don’t miss a visit to the iconic Dunkirk Lighthouse, offering panoramic views of the coastline after a rewarding climb up its spiral staircase. Lastly, indulge in the local gastronomy at La Guinguette, where fresh seafood and regional specialities are served with a view of the harbour.
